The Itinerary: What You Can Expect

Guided snorkeling trip to the turtles in Protaras - The Itinerary: What You Can Expect

This snorkeling trip is designed to give you a solid, memorable encounter with Cyprus’s marine life—specifically, its sea turtles. The whole experience lasts around three hours, starting at 3:00 pm, which is perfect if you’re looking to combine it with other afternoon activities or just enjoy a relaxed late-day outing.

Pickup and Meeting Point: The tour offers a convenient pickup, so you won’t have to worry about finding the spot yourself. If you prefer to meet directly, you’ll be at the designated location in Protaras. The small group size (maximum four travelers) means you’ll enjoy a more personalized experience, with attentive guidance from the marine biologists leading the way.

Preparation and Equipment: Before entering the water, you’ll receive all necessary snorkeling gear—fins, masks, snorkels—ensuring you’re well-equipped to enjoy the underwater world. The focus here is on observing the turtles in their natural surroundings, rather than a long, exhaustive underwater expedition.

Educational Moment: Expect a significant portion of your time to be spent at the dive center, where you’ll learn about the turtles and their conservation efforts. This part is important for understanding the species you’re about to see but can be a bit lengthy, as one reviewer noted that much of their time was spent in the dive center learning.

The Turtle Encounter: What It’s Like

Your main goal on this tour is to spot sea turtles—most likely species like the green sea turtle, as one guest described seeing up close. The water in Cyprus is famously clear, offering excellent visibility that makes spotting these creatures easier and more thrilling.

Authentic Encounters: The chances of seeing a turtle are quite high, which is part of the appeal. Given that the tour is led by specialists, they can point out details you might miss on your own and answer any questions about the animals and their habits.

Authentic Experiences: One traveler recounted seeing a green sea turtle up close, though it was being chased by other travelers. This points to the popularity of the spot and the need for respectful observation. The fact that the tour has a high success rate in turtle sightings makes it a worthwhile adventure for wildlife lovers.

Discovering Unrecorded Species: If you’re lucky, you might even spot a turtle that isn’t yet recorded in the conservation database. And if that happens, you and your guide can get creative and come up with a name for your new discovery—a fun and memorable aspect of the trip.

Considerations Before Booking

  • Timing: The tour starts at 3:00 pm, so plan accordingly. The late afternoon timing often offers calmer waters and softer light, which makes snorkeling more enjoyable.
  • Duration: At roughly three hours, it’s a manageable outing for most, but if you’re expecting a long, relaxed swim, keep in mind the time spent in the educational part might be longer than in the water.
  • Weather Dependency: Like all outdoor water activities, good weather is essential. If the weather turns poor, the experience can be canceled or rescheduled with a full refund.
  • Group Size: The small group is a perk but also means spots fill up about 25 days in advance on average—so plan ahead if you’re set on doing it.
